Monitoring of wind speed and solar radiation at the Wiesengrundbach in Saxony in Germany in March 2022

DOI

Measurements of the microclimate were carried out at the Wiesengrundbach in Saxony in Germany. Some of the measurements were single measurements (wind speed, gust velocity and solar radiation) and some were continuous measurements (water level and water temperature) with periods of several months. The study area covers a 1 kilometer long river section. The data were collected in order to assess the extent to which the water temperature is influenced by the riparian vegetation. The sensors in the water body (water level and water temperature) were installed on the river bed.
